Colorado Statutes

§ 29-1-802 — Definitions

Colorado·Title 29 Government·Art. Budget and Services

As used in this part 8, unless the context otherwise requires:

(1)Capital expenditure means any expenditure for an improvement, facility, or piece of equipment necessitated by land development which is directly related to a local government service, has an estimated useful life of five years or longer, and is required by charter or general policy of a local government pursuant to resolution or ordinance.
(2)Land development means any of the following:
(a)The subdivision of land;
(b)Construction, reconstruction, redevelopment, or conversion of use of land or any structural alteration, relocation, or enlargement which results in an increase in the number of service units required; or
